Here you will be able to camp peacefully near a beautiful mountain stream in a historical New England town. Bring your friends and dogs, even bring your atv and check out some of the local trails. The sites are of your choosing. We are near hiking, kayaking, fishing, cycling, hang gliding and para sailing.Pitch your tent at Brookside camping. Here you can camp near the site and walk a short distance to the site of your choosing. You will feel you're in the wilderness next to a babbling brook. Near by is historic ruins, water skiing, kayaking, fishing, swimming. The town features a general store and plenty of atv trails if you wish.
